Question 1170322: Formulate a quadratic equation then answer what is asked in the problem.
John can answer all the problem solving in the activity in Math 9 module within 24 hours alone. But Justine can answer it 4 hours more than John. How long will it take Justine to answer? How many hours to finish answering the activity if they worked together?
